Done Living This Way Poem by Emmanuel Joseph Olumakiss

Aren't you done living this way?
To save this heart from further dismay
Claiming what you are not
And not knowing your worth
From this very act when will you refrain?
From things that are eating up your brain
Having legs but walking with clutches
Looking old but living like apprentice
When good thoughts approach your senses
You do stuff without taking chances
Severally you've sworn travelling to the past
It seems you barely keep to a stand
When will you flee from that that entice the eyes?
When will you outgrow doing what is not really nice?
Reserving a heart to one who don't know you exist
Doing things different from what you preach
When out of control;
You hand your entire life to your foes.
